S4E1 - Niels Niethard - Neural mechanisms underpinning sleep

About this episode

In this episode, we’re joined by Dr. Niels Niethard from the University of Tübingen to explore what sleep looks like at the level of cortical microcircuits — and how excitation and inhibition are dynamically reconfigured across brain states.

Niels walks us through how excitatory pyramidal neurons interact with distinct inhibitory interneuron populations, including somatostatin (SST) and parvalbumin (PV) cells. We discuss how these cell-type-specific interactions shift from wakefulness to non-REM sleep and into REM, creating fundamentally different circuit configurations across sleep stages.

We discuss how sleep spindles, slow oscillations, and REM sleep each create distinct configurations of dendritic and somatic inhibition. Niels explains how spindle timing relative to slow oscillation peaks influences synaptic plasticity and how these processes support selective memory consolidation.

The conversation also touches on his work on synaptic downscaling in cortical and hypothalamic networks, the potential link between AMPA receptor regulation and sleep pressure, and how sleep interacts with feeding-related circuits and metabolic state in mice.

This episode offers a detailed, cell-type-specific perspective on how excitation and inhibition are balanced across sleep stages, revealing the microcircuit mechanisms underlying memory, synaptic downscaling, and brain homeostasis.
